Transaction 75eab7c93a55f56a60464d553f6c1abc0189521b429590c58d4b74b825544ae8
1 Input
1 Output
-
75eab7c93a55f56a60464d553f6c1abc0189521b429590c58d4b74b825544ae8:0
- value
- 95751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d380ed48578f55a1094ac67513b88410d85ddba6 OP_EQUAL
- address
- 3LyLx1wRHY82hMT9brEb1zPe7nrG6UG7hs